ATL. Home of so many things including, breaking rap artist, the most black owned record labels and of course the biggest strip club circuit in any city. Let’s add another. THE OPEN MIC. Currently there are no less than 20+ weekly open mics, showcases, and industry nights where an artist in the atl can “get their shine on”,and a undisputed name that goes hand and hand with the origin of the ATL open mic circuit is B.RICH. A native Atlantan, and North Atlanta High graduate; in the underground music network B.RICH’s name is definitely one that is as familiar as the words “grindin” and “networkin”. In 2003 Brich teamed up with Alfonzo Maze of Amazin Productions and started doing open mics, hiring now ATL widely known Akini tha Black Mac to host. The 3 enjoyed quick success, but as we all know happens quite often in the music biz, decided to go their separate ways after little more than a year. But B-RICH entertainment was off and running, and now with just 3 yrs under its belt is one the leading underground entertainment houses in Atlanta.
Branching in many directions, the entertainment company has become affiliated with Ga Durt, which host members such as Bohagan and Playboy Tre, and has also formed a partnership with northern based Defiant Records which is headed by Warner Music’s Greg Calloway, and the duo together are working on up and coming artist B.o.B & Willie Joe who is creating a huge buz in the Atlanta underground music market. If that wasn’t enough, B.Rich Ent also has established itself as a producing powerhouse, teaming with “The Klinic”, producing hard tracks such as the underground hit “The Cookie Man” by City, which came about when Brich suggested that City do a song about a lyric from a PlayBoy Tre song called Life. Brich states hard work, and keeping faith in people has helped him to keep pushin in this over competitive industry.
